HOBOMOCK POND IS BEING TREATED FOR THE NON-NATIVE AND HIGHLY INVASIVE PLANT HYDRILLA.
IN AN EFFORT TO PREVENT THE SPREAD OF THIS INVASIVE SPECIES TO OTHER AREA PONDS, HOBOMOCK POND WILL BE CLOSED TO ALL BOATING. THIS CLOSURE IS PER THE ORDER OF THE PEMBROKE CONSERVATION COMMISSION AND WILL REMAIN IN EFFECT UNTIL FURTHER NOTICE. see full notice. 4/27/11
Pembroke is well known for the many ponds in town. There are also beautiful beaches at some of them.
There are three town beaches in Pembroke. They are on Little Sandy Bottom Pond, Stetson Pond and Oldham Pond (Town Landing.)
Swimming lessons are offered at both Town Landing on Wampatuck Street and Little Sandy Beach on Woodbine Ave during the summer. Call Town Landing Guardhouse 781-293-3082 for swimming lesson information.

Hobomock Pond is now open to passive recreational uses, boating of any kind will remain prohibited until further notice.
The Dept. of Public Health found high levels of bacteria due to a blue/green algae bloom at Stetson Pond. They recommended that the Board of Health advise residents that there should be no water contact. No swimming and no fishing at Stetson Pond until further notice. There will be posters at the pond.
